Many of these strollers have a front-wheel that can be swiveled, making it easier to maneuver around tight spaces.<br /><br />When choosing a stroller, you must also think about how it will perform on different conditions. A 3-wheel stroller can handle bumpy sidewalks, but it's not recommended to use it on escalators or steep hills. The front wheel alone is susceptible to getting clogged up with debris, such as stones or grass. A stroller with four wheels is more stable and less likely to tip when navigating steep slopes or escalators.<br /><br /><br /><br />A 3-wheel stroller or jogging stroller can be a great option for parents who wish to exercise with their child. These strollers feature large rear wheels and a lockable, swivel front wheel that makes them easy to move. These strollers can be used for jogging on uneven or rough terrain, such as trails and gravel roads. If you plan to use your stroller as a jogger, select one with rubber air or foam filled tires to get the best ride.<br /><br />It's important to note that although most strollers can be taken on stairs and escalators however, it's not recommended. Falls on escalators or steps are the most common cause of stroller-related injuries, and they can be dangerous to your baby. If you need to use an escalator or stairs, it's best to bring along someone who can help you lift the stroller up or down.<br /><br />Folding is simple<br /><br />This lightweight option is much more compact than other strollers.
